That's normal since Assetto Corsa is a highly threaded game. The biggest question is how is this all negatively impacting your overall experience? If you're hitting your frame rate target without stuttering while running all your normal apps I see zero issue if you happen to have high CPU usage.

The 6800k is an expensive high end CPU. Anything else is pretty much a side grade. Realistically wait for DX11 and see how that impacts your performance.

You will always get 100% CPU usage if you dont limit your framerate ingame and let it render infite FPS. You already have a very powerful CPU as mentioned. ~150fps is all you need.
And make sure to check all your cpu throttling programs/utilities aswell, that they dont go on power saving modes or whatever.
